> I have the same annoyance with ccsrbar.
> 
> U-boot controls the ccsrbar address via a user configured #define.
> So instead of having different dts's based on the u-boot ccsrbar,
> why can't u-boot update the device tree?

That will require that U-Boot know where every instance of CCSRBAR is
within the tree, which seems fragile.  Do we have any instances yet of
updating unit addresses from U-Boot?  What about aliases that reference
said unit addresses?
